Tony Perez played in 8 games at first base for the Cincinnati Reds in 1970, starting in 4 of them. He played for a total of 119 outs, equivalent to 4.41 9-inning games.

He made 36 putouts, had 6 assists, and committed no errors, equivalent to 0 errors per 9-inning game. He had 4 double plays.
